The first Monday in May is the set date for the annual Met Gala - and yesterday the theme for 2024's event was announced: "Sleeping Beauties: Reawakening Fashion." The gala is set to feature 250 items from the Costume Institute’s permanent collection, according to an Instagram post announcing the theme. "From a 17th-century English Elizabethan-era bodice and Christian Dior’s famous Junon and Venus ballgowns to 21st-century acquisitions by designers including Phillip Lim, Stella McCartney, and Conner Ives, the core exhibit will span 400 years of history.” The big party goes down May 6.
